python2 讀取excle中的數據時,對於漢字的讀取報錯: 代碼:data[num][4]={"content": "測試"} data=data[num][4] UnicodeEncodeError: 'ascii' codec can't encode ...
最近業務中需要用 Python 寫一些腳本。盡管腳本的交互只是命令行 日志輸出,但是為了讓界面友好些,我還是決定用中文輸出日志信息。 很快,我就遇到了異常: Python代碼 UnicodeEncodeError: ascii codeccan tencodecharactersinposition :ordinalnotinrange 為了解決問題,我花時間去研究了一下 Python 的字符編碼 ...
2017-04-05 07:38 0 4713 推薦指數:
python2 讀取excle中的數據時,對於漢字的讀取報錯: 代碼:data[num][4]={"content": "測試"} data=data[num][4] UnicodeEncodeError: 'ascii' codec can't encode ...
我在學python的過程中,遇到的第二個問題,就是中文亂碼,如今也算勉強入門了,在這里給大家說說我的經驗,也算個新人引導吧。 在文章里,我會重點提到一個概念:有來有去。 即數據從哪里來,到哪里 ...
日志的格式是GBK編碼的,而hadoop上的編碼是用UTF-8寫死的,導致最終輸出亂碼。 研究了下Java的編碼問題。 網上其實對spark輸入文件是GBK編碼有現成的解決方案,具體代碼如下 這種想法的來源是基於 但這種方法還有一個問題, 大家都知道gbk ...
Python 中文編碼 為了處理漢字,程序員設計了用於簡體中文的GB2312和用於繁體中文的big5. GB2312(1980年)一共收錄了7445個字符,包括6763個漢子和682個其他符號。漢字區的內碼范圍高字節從B0-E7,低字節A1-FE,占用的碼位是72*94 ...
下文轉自 http://blog.csdn.net/mayflowers/article/details/1568852 1. 在Python中使用中文 在Python中有兩種默認的字符串:str和unicode。在Python中一定要注意區分“Unicode字符串 ...
中文編碼問題是用中文的程序員經常頭大的問題,在python下也是如此,那么應該怎么理解和解決python的編碼問題呢? 我們要知道python內部使用的是unicode編碼,而外部卻要面對千奇百怪的各種編碼,比如作為中國程序經常要面對的gbk,gb2312,utf8等,那這些編碼是怎么轉換成內部 ...
(data.content.decode("utf-8")) 注: 上述可能filename不支持中文名,可以 D:\Us ...
在python2列表中,有時候,想打印一個列表,會出現如下顯示: 這個是由於: print一個對象,是輸出其“為了給人(最終用戶)閱讀”而設計的輸出形式,那么字符串中的轉義字符需要轉出來,而且 也不要帶標識字符串邊界的引號。 因此,單獨打印列表中的某一項,譬如:list ...